The Hidden Cost of Generic AI Tools in Wealth Management

Off-the-shelf no-code platforms like Zapier and Make.com promise quick automation wins—yet in wealth management, they often deliver hidden risks instead of real value. These tools lack the compliance-first design, data ownership, and enterprise-grade security required in regulated financial environments.

For firms handling sensitive client data, generic AI integrations introduce critical vulnerabilities.
- They rarely support SOX or GDPR compliance by default
- Data flows through third-party servers, increasing privacy exposure
- Custom logic for audit trails and approval workflows is difficult or impossible to enforce

According to KPMG research, 50% of global business executives plan to allocate budgets for generative AI in the next year—but without proper governance, adoption can amplify risk. Meanwhile, Botpress analysis reveals that 77% of firms using predictive analytics achieve faster decision-making, underscoring the value of intentional AI deployment.

Consider a mid-sized advisory firm that attempted to automate client reporting using Zapier. The workflow broke when CRM fields changed, causing misaligned portfolio data in client deliverables. Worse, unsanctioned data routing violated internal compliance protocols, triggering a regulatory review.

This isn’t an isolated case. Integration fragility is a common flaw: no-code tools depend on public APIs that change without notice, disrupting mission-critical processes. When systems fail silently, the result is inaccurate reports, delayed filings, or non-compliant communications.

Moreover, these platforms offer no ownership of AI assets. Firms pay recurring fees to rent workflows they can’t fully control, customize, or secure. Over time, this leads to subscription fatigue and technical debt.

The real cost isn’t just financial—it’s reputational and regulatory. A single compliance lapse can damage client trust and attract penalties. As Forbes Councils members note, AI must be deployed with human oversight and embedded compliance—requirements generic tools simply can’t meet.

Imagine generating hyper-personalized quarterly reports for hundreds of clients—each aligned with individual risk profiles, regulatory disclosures, and data privacy rules—without manual review delays. That’s the power of a dual-RAG knowledge retrieval system.

This AI engine pulls from two secure knowledge bases:
- One containing client-specific data (investment history, preferences, compliance status)
- The other housing regulatory guidelines (SOX controls, GDPR clauses, SEC disclosure templates)

By cross-referencing both in real time, the system ensures every output is accurate, personalized, and compliant. It eliminates the risk of hallucinations or outdated disclosures—a common flaw in off-the-shelf AI tools.

For example, when a client requests a performance summary, the engine automatically includes required disclaimers based on jurisdiction and account type. Every generated document logs its data sources and compliance checks, creating an auditable trail.
